vue2使用笔记、vue2vue3的区别
原创 2月前
230阅读
创建一个 template 组件来说,大多代码在Vue2Vue3都非常相似。Vue3支持碎片(Fragments)
原创 2022-03-01 17:59:28
3022阅读
增加特性 composition API: setup(): 是composition API 的入口函数 仅初始化时执行一次。(具体是在beforecreate之前执行。此时的this为undefined,所以在setup()无法使用this获取数据) 所有的compostion API都写在 s ...
转载 2021-08-28 14:16:00
616阅读
2评论
生命周期对于生命周期来说,整体上变化不大,只是大部分生命周期钩子名称上 + “on”,功能上是类似的。不过有一点需要注意,Vue3 在组合式API(Composition API,下面展开)中使用生命周期钩子时需要先引入,而 Vue2 在选项API(Options API)中可以直接调用生命周期钩子,如下所示。vue2vue3说明beforeCreatesetup组件创建之前,执行初始化任务cre
原创 精选 2024-03-03 08:03:21
629阅读
vue3vue2版本对比:vue2中绝大多数的API与特性,在vue3中同样支持。同时,vue3中还新增了所特有的功能,并废弃了vue2中的某些旧功能。新增的功能如:组合式API、多根节点组件、更好的TypeScript支持等。废弃的功能如:过滤器、不在支持$on,$off,$once等实例方法。详细变更信息可参考官方文档的迁徙指南:https://v3.vuejs.org/guide/migr
转载 2024-04-02 12:29:03
186阅读
vue2<template>   <div class='form-element'>     <h2> {{ title }} </h2>     <input type='text' v-model='username' placeholder='Username' />          <input type='passwo
转载 2021-04-20 22:10:21
292阅读
2评论
1. 响应式系统的重构Vue 2使用 Object.defineProperty 实现响应式,存在以下限制:无法检测对象属性的新增/删除(需通过 Vue.set/Vue.delete)。对数组的索引操作(如 arr[index] = value)长度修改无法触发响应式更新。Vue 3改用 Proxy 实现响应式,解决了上述限制
原创 7月前
124阅读
Vue 3 Vue 2 是两个不同版本的 Vue.js 框架,它们之间存在一些关键差异性能:Vue 3 在性能方面进行了优化,提供了更快的渲染速度更低的内存占用。这使得 Vue 3 更适合构建大型应用程序。组合 API:Vue 3 引入了一种新的 API,称为组合 API,它允许开发者在 setup 函数中使用 ref reactive 等方法来定义操作响应式数据。这使得代码更加模块化
原创 2024-04-14 11:22:35
141阅读
          diff VUE2 and VUE3VUE2Object.defineProperty(),重写对象的key对数组能进行监听,但删除、插入、排序等频繁操的大量的读写操作,会带来性能问题真正的问题是,不能对初始化时没有设置的键值做监听。所以要提供Vue.set等API需要一开始初始化就递归遍历,循环监听,也是性能瓶颈之一VUE3使用proxy拦截读写操作,采用懒代理解决深度嵌套问
转载 2021-03-20 16:56:00
1197阅读
2评论
全局安装/配置API更改我们可以发现我们在实例化配置应用程序的方式上又有了一个重大的变化。我们现在就来看看它的工作原理://vue2 import Vue from 'vue'import App from './App.vue'Vue.config.ignoredElements = [/^app-/] Vue.use(/* ... */) Vue.mixin(/* ... */) Vue.c
转载 2021-02-25 17:08:39
541阅读
2评论
Vue.js 作为当前最流行的前端框架之一,在 2020 年 9 月发布了 3.0 版本(Vue3)。这个重大更新带来了许多改进新特性。作为长期使用 Vue 的开发者,我想分享一下 Vue2 Vue3 之间的主要区别。 1. 性能提升 Vue3 在性能方面做了大量优化: 更小的体积:Vue3 通过更好的代码组织 Tree-shaking 支持,体积比 Vue2 小了约 40% 更快的渲染
vue
原创 4月前
125阅读
Vue2Vue3之间存在一些关键的区别,这些区别主要体现在以下几个方面:
原创 2024-05-31 13:17:27
0阅读
Vue.js 作为当前最流行的前端框架之一,在 2020 年 9 月发布了 3.0 版本(Vue3)。这个重大更新带来了许多改进新特性。作为长期使用 Vue 的开发者,我想分享一下 Vue2 Vue3 之间的主要区别。性能提升 Vue3 在性能方面做了大量优化:更小的体积:Vue3 通过更好的代码组织 Tree-shaking 支持,体积比 Vue2 小了约 40% 更快的渲染:虚拟 DO
转载 4月前
62阅读
跨域设置 http://www.ituring.com.cn/article/200275 打包 npm adduser 如果长时间不登录,可能会过期,使用 npm login 进行登录就可以 pu
原创 2021-07-23 11:32:15
393阅读
eslint用于代码检查,prettier用于代码格式化,具体操作如下1.安装以下eslint插件 安装以下eslint插件,并增加.eslintrc.js配置文件,.eslintignore配置忽略检查的文件(1)eslint 用于检查标示出ECMAScript/JavaScript代码规范问题工具。 (2)@babel/eslint-parser 简而言之就是一个解析器,允许您使用ES
转载 2024-05-29 12:57:59
283阅读
vue3跟vue2区别?
原创 11月前
0阅读
main.js App.vue action.js getters.js index.js mutation.js types.js
转载 2017-06-24 05:50:00
220阅读
vue2
原创 2021-08-01 18:40:40
412阅读
摘要: 本文旨在深入探讨 Vue2 Vue3 之间的区别。通过对两者在响应式原理、模板语法、组件系统、性能优化等多个方面的对比分析,展现它们各自的特点优势,为开发者在选择使用 Vue 版本时提供参考依据。一、引言Vue.js 是一款流行的 JavaScript 前端框架,广泛应用于构建用户界面。Vue2 在长期的发展中积累了大量的用户项目,但随着技术的发展,Vue3 的推出带来了
原创 11月前
594阅读
最近项目开发中遇到需要用到ie浏览器的情况,因为是内网开发,大致记录下兼容过程。问题1:ie11浏览器页面无法加载首先遇到的问题是谷歌浏览器运行无问题,控制台也不报错,但是ie11浏览器就打不开,控制台报错----显示语法错误:,了解后发现ie浏览器不支持es6,可以通过core-js/stable及regenerator-runtime/runtime编译,vue cli官方推荐使用,main.
转载 2024-04-03 14:52:36
210阅读
  • 1
  • 2
  • 3
  • 4
  • 5